Chapter 138: Dabao Binds the “Do Good Deeds, Have Great Luck” System

Qiu Yinuo’s smile began to crack. As expected, this mischievous child wasn’t as easy to fool as a one-year-old.

“Dabao, what are you saying? Am I not your gentle, beautiful, considerate, and kind mother?”

Dabao shivered instinctively and mumbled, “Mom, just talk normally.”

Though his words were unclear, Qiu Yinuo understood them perfectly.

“Alright then, Mom has a piece of great news for you. But you mustn’t get too excited when you hear it.”

Dabao had a bad feeling about this. “What good news?”

“Mom picked a system that’s just perfect for you. If you think it’s okay, go ahead and bind it with Menghua!”

Dabao tilted his head. “Mom, what kind of dirt does Menghua have on you?”

Qiu Yinuo: “……”

He really was her son—spot on with just one guess.

“Are you going to bind with a system too?”

The words ‘No way in hell’ nearly slipped out, but she swallowed them back just in time.

Forcing a smile she thought looked kind and understanding, Qiu Yinuo said, “Mom just thinks Dabao is old enough to start carrying some responsibilities for the family…”

Dabao instantly panicked and let out a flurry of frantic babbling, unable to form a proper sentence.

Finally, he stuck out one chubby finger and jabbed it at himself repeatedly to wordlessly say—I’m only one year old!

What kind of joke was this? Asking a one-year-old to take on family responsibilities?

Qiu Yinuo grabbed his chubby finger and smiled. “Alright, Mom knows you’re a brave and dependable little man. That’s why I’m giving you this opportunity to carry the family forward.”

Dabao scrambled to get up and run, but before his stubby legs could move an inch, he was scooped up tightly into his mother’s arms.

“Dabao, my sweet son,” Qiu Yinuo cooed, holding him tight, “just say yes to Menghua, okay? Back then I was trying to save someone, and that sly little system used it to threaten me. Just help Mommy out, alright?”

Dabao stared in disbelief at his mom, who was just a hair away from rolling on the ground like a tantruming child. For the first time in his life, his expectations of parenthood were completely shattered.

He had always thought of dads as dignified figures, and moms as warm and forgiving.

Now, being held by a mom who looked as if she might burst into tears at any moment, he felt like the world no longer made sense.

Qiu Yinuo clung to her despairing son like a child denied candy. “Dabao, you know Erbao is a local-born. He really is only one year old. The only person I can rely on now is you.”

“Please? If you don’t agree, I’ll annoy you every single day from now on.”

Dabao used all his strength to push her away, but she didn’t budge an inch. Instead, she hugged him even tighter.

“Mom, can you act like a normal mom? And stop rubbing your face on mine,” he groaned, feeling like one of those poor people in his past life being smothered by overly clingy golden retrievers in viral videos.

Qiu Yinuo pouted in dissatisfaction.

It was hard to believe someone in her twenties could act so childishly without any sense of shame.

Actually, with her soft cheeks and slightly rounded face, she looked adorably childish.

Dabao blinked in a daze, unable to understand how his mom could be so different from everyone else’s.

“Who says moms have to act a certain way? Your mom is just like this. Dabao, my precious boy, please say yes. Please?”

Hiding in the space, Menghua couldn’t bear to watch any longer. It silently raised its thick panda paw and covered its eyes.

Too much. Just too much!

Humans really knew how to play.

It had assumed she’d take on the usual motherly authority—if not a firm command, then at least a little pressure to make Dabao bind the system.

Who would’ve thought she’d resort to snuggling and acting shameless! That level of childishness was something else.

Dabao only felt that his little heart inside his chest was beating with delight.

It was the strange, unfamiliar feeling of being needed. Both foreign and oddly exciting.

His tiny face remained tense as he forcibly suppressed the upward curve of his lips.

With Qiu Yinuo clinging and kissing him like crazy, Dabao finally agreed with a performance of reluctant acceptance.

“Well, it’s true. I’m the only man left in the family who can carry the burden. You’re my mom—of course I’ll help you.”

“So… that means you agree?”

“Mm-hmm,” Dabao pouted. “What kind of system do you want me to bind with?”

Even though she had obviously tricked him, Dabao still believed—deep down—his mom would never truly harm him.

“The ‘Do Good Deeds, Have Great Luck’ system.” Qiu Yinuo clapped her hands and summoned the system. “Menghua, come explain it to Dabao.”

At this point, 3224 no longer cared how silly the name Menghua sounded. It happily rolled out of the space.

Dabao stared in shock and pointed at the sudden appearance of Menghua. “Ah, ah, ah! It can come out?”

Menghua grumbled to itself: I’m not your private space property, of course I can come out.

“Won’t people see it?”

“Relax, only you two can see me.” Wasting no time, Menghua energetically began explaining the system. The first lure it threw out? Complete a task, and you’ll get a crispy, golden fried chicken drumstick.

A fried chicken drumstick!

Mother and son instinctively swallowed a mouthful of saliva in perfect sync. Sure, they’d eaten chicken before, but since arriving here, they hadn’t had anything fried.

Oil here was precious. People barely used it for cooking, let alone for deep-frying.

They thought back to the fried chicken from their past life—crispy skin, slathered in thick honey mustard sauce…

Sluuuurp!

And this time, Dabao wasn’t the only one drooling.

Qiu Yinuo asked eagerly, “Can we choose which sauce to use?”

Menghua proudly lifted its head. “Of course. We’ve got over ten kinds of sauces for hosts to pick from.”

Dabao raised his chubby little hand. “I wanna bind! Quick, quick!”

He couldn’t wait a second longer.

Menghua spun in joy.

Ding! “Loading host’s system. Connecting to main server. Please wait…”

Ding! “Host: Shao Xingchen. Would you like to bind the ‘Do Good Deeds, Have Great Luck’ system?”

A control panel appeared before Dabao, with two options underneath.

“Host, please click ‘Yes.’”

Dabao couldn’t hold back anymore. He reached out his little hand and clicked ‘Yes’. Instantly, a progress bar began to load.

When it finally reached 100%, a cheerful chime rang out.

Ding! “Binding complete! Hello, host. I am your exclusive system—Menghua.”

Dabao: “……” Absolutely shameless.

Qiu Yinuo: “……” Could a system be any more spineless? It even changed its own name voluntarily.

“I want a fried chicken drumstick! Hurry up and give me my first mission!”

“Alright. Please complete your first task: Go to the toilet at the east end of the village and deliver toilet paper to Grandpa Li. Reward: one fragrant, crispy fried chicken drumstick.”

Dabao, who had been eagerly waiting for his grand debut: ???

Qiu Yinuo couldn’t hold it in and burst out laughing.

Menghua tilted its head in confusion as Dabao stood frozen. “Dabao, why haven’t you gone yet?”

Fuming, Dabao plopped down and started kicking his legs. “How is that a good deed!? I have to smell the stink of the toilet? How can I eat a fragrant fried chicken drumstick after that?”

Qiu Yinuo, not showing a shred of motherly compassion, said cheerfully, “Dabao, it’s okay—Mommy can eat it for you!”
